On Tue, Sep 13, 2022 at 12:56:37PM -0600, Raul Rangel wrote:
> On Tue, Sep 13, 2022 at 12:33 PM Andy Shevchenko
> <and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com> wrote:
> > On Tue, Sep 13, 2022 at 12:07:53PM -0600, Raul Rangel wrote:
...
> > This is similar to what of_i2c_get_board_info() does, no?
> > Note: _get_ there.
>
> `*info` is an out parameter in that case. Ideally I would have
> `i2c_acpi_get_irq`, `acpi_dev_gpio_irq_get_wake`,
> `platform_get_irq_optional`, and `i2c_dev_irq_from_resources` all
> return a `struct irq_info {int irq; bool wake_capable;}`. This would
> be a larger change though.
Seems the ACPI analogue is i2c_acpi_fill_info(). Can we do it there?
